Transponder Keys
Transponder keys are an advanced type of car keys that include an electronic microchip. The chip transmits an unique coded signal each time you insert the key into the ignition. The system validates the code and permits the engine to start when it receives the code. However, sometimes a malfunctioning microchip can cause your car to fail. You'll need to call an expert locksmith for your vehicle to replace the microchip.
The process of reprogramming a transponder car key is different from creating a new one, since it requires special equipment and training. It's also more expensive than creating an original key. However, a locksmith who is a professional can easily program your transponder keys at less than the price you'd have to pay to replace it.
Professional locksmiths will cut an entirely new key that matches the locks on your vehicle. The locksmith will then transfer your unique code from the ECU to the transponder chip. The key will be tested to make sure it is working properly.
Transponder keys can be duplicated, however, it is a lot more difficult. They offer better security, and are a deterrent for thieves. They can also help you save on your insurance costs.

ford focus remote key Fobs
A remote key fob has an embedded microchip that emits radio frequencies that is accompanied by a specific, unique digital identity code that your car can recognize. It is used to open your doors or to start your engine. The fob transmits a number to the vehicle's receiver each time you hit the button. It is always searching for the correct signal. Many modern cars use a rolling key code that is changed each time the fob is activated. This makes it harder for criminals to replicate or hack the signals.

Keyless Entry
Some modern vehicles have keyless entry systems that remove the need for traditional keys. The system lets drivers unlock their vehicles by pressing a button on the genuine ford key replacement fob or, in the case of newer models, just walking towards the car and pressing it. These systems are more convenient and make it safer to drive at night or in areas with snow and ice.
Smart keys are usually included in the technology packages and the trim levels that are higher in trim However, they can be purchased as a basic option on a wide range of models. In a typical system, the car transmits an electronic signal to the key fob, which transmits a number back. The car recognizes the code, unlocks or locks doors. These keys are more secure than traditional keys since they are inherently secure and cannot be tampered with.
